The goal of Leadership Northwest is to identify, educate, and encourage emerging community leaders to use their leadership skills for long-term benefit of the community. When selecting the 2024-2025 class, priority will be given to those individuals who have a positive response to the following statements:
-
I have a sincere commitment, motivation, and interest to serve the Northwest Tarrant County community.
-
I have an occupational commitment to remain in Northwest Tarrant County.
-
I have an interest in holding public office or being involved in key volunteer leadership roles in the community.
-
I will be able to attend and actively participate in the monthly sessions that will be held on the second Thursday of each month from 8:30 am to 4:30 pm.
-
I will commit to assist with the planning/coordinating of two sessions of the 2025-2026 Leadership Northwest Program.

Rules & Expectations
-
Attend each Leadership Northwest session. Be there on time and stay until the session ends. Mixers and receptions are optional, but they do allow you to network.
-
Two excused sessions are allowed. If more than two sessions are missed, discretion will be used to determine if time may be made up the following year to complete the program and graduate with the next year’s class. Keep your Leadership Northwest experience confidential where appropriate. This will help speakers feel more comfortable to discuss sensitive issues more openly. In addition, certain experiences may lose their impact if shared with non-participants, and fellow classmates need to know what they say is confidential. Furthermore, you may hear about projects and announcements before they become public information.
-
Complete evaluation forms at the end of every session. Your detailed comments and suggestions help determine future improvements to the program and will be considered in the planning of future sessions.
-
Please limit interruptions for yourself and others during session tours by silencing your cell phones.
-
Get the most out of your participation. When you are in a leadership session, focus your energy by asking questions and speaking to fellow classmates and leaders. Prepare the day before by completing tasks at work so you can concentrate on the Leadership Northwest session. When possible, ride the bus with the group. This enhances the whole experience by keeping the group together and allowing more time to get to know your classmates.
-
Leadership Northwest is here to focus on, and develop, your leadership talents. Be prepared for anything: long days, surprise occurrences, stepping out of your comfort zone.
